r语言如何提取指定列名数据
最简单的方法,数据框的名称,加上你要提取的列数,示例如下: 需要注意的是,如果只提取单列的话,得到的数据就变成了一个vector,而不再是dataframe的格式了。 首先,导入R语言需要加载xlsx包,没有安装这个包的,请用下面的代码进行在线安装:
install.packages("xlsx")选择China的任意一个镜像站点,它会自动安装其他所需的依赖包。
安装好xlsx包后,接下来导入存放在“C:\Users\HWT\Desktop”路径下的“test.xlsx”文件,导入这个文件的代码如下: library(xlsx) read.xlsx2(file="C:\\Users\\HWT\\Desktop\\test.xlsx",sheetIndex=1) 我们上面的代码只是把test.xlsx导入了R语言,并没有把它赋给R语言里的某个对象,用下面的代码把数据赋给对象Mydata: Mydata-read.xlsx2(file="C:\\Users\\HWT\\Desktop\\test.xlsx",sheetIndex=1)。
R语言可以通过选择指定的列名来提取数据。
在R语言中,可以使用代码subset(dataframe, select = c(column_name_1, column_name_2))来选择指定的列名,可以用于提取数据,使得我们可以更方便地进行数据分析。
除了subset()函数,还可以使用sqldf包或者dplyr包进行指定列名的数据提取,这些方法都拥有不同的优点和适用场景。
在实际应用中,需要根据具体数据和需求进行选择。
R是N的子集吗
不是。N全体非负整数(或自然数)组成的集合;R是实数集;Z是整数集;Q是有理数集;Z*是正整数集;N*是正整数集。
集合及运算的概念
集合:一般的,一定范围内某些确定的,不同的对象的全体构成一个集合。
子集:对于两个集合A和B,如果集合A中的任意一个元素都是集合B中的元素,我们就说这两个集合有包含关系,称集合A是集合B的子集,记作A⊆B读作A包含于B。
空集:不含任何元素的集合叫做空集。记为Φ。
离散数学R是等价关系证明:R复合R是R的子集
题目是正确的。
若R复合R中的任意元素都属于R,则R复合R是R的子集:
对于R⊙R的任意元素<x,y>,必存在z,且有<x,z>属于R和<z,y>属于R。
由于R是等价关系,即R满足传递性,则由<x,z>属于R和<z,y>属于R,可知<x,y>属于R。综上,R复合R是R的子集。
关于集合中属于与子集的区别
一个集合中的任一元素必定属于已知集合,这就是集合中属于的概念。而一个集合中的任一元素均可构成已知集合的单元素子集,当然已知集合中的任意个元素亦可构成此集合的子集,这就是集合中子集的概念。如:实数集R中的元素1,1属于R,{1}是R的单元素子集。这就是集合中属于与子集的区别。
还没有评论,来说两句吧...